Simptomi
Pieņemiet, ka izveidojat priekšrakstu SELECT no Pure External Tables (vismaz viena no tiem ir krātuves pūla tabula) programmā SQL Server 2019 un ievietojiet saņemtos datus citā ārējā tabulā tajā pašā pārskatā, iespējams, tiek parādīts šāds kļūdas ziņojums:
Msg 7320, Level 16, State 102, Line rindas numurs%
Nevar izpildīt vaicājumu "Attālais vaicājums", salīdzinot ar OLE DB nodrošinātāju "MSOLEDBSQL" ar saistīto serveri "Null". Tikai domēns pieteikšanos var izmantot, lai vaicātu Kerberized krātuves pūlu.
Statusa
Microsoft ir apstiprinājusi, ka šī problēma pastāv Microsoft produktos, kas ir norādīti sadaļā "attiecas uz".
Risinājums
Šī problēma ir novērsta Šis SQL Server kumulatīvais atjauninājums:
Par SQL Server kumulatīvie atjauninājumi:
Katrs jaunais kumulatīvais SQL Server atjauninājums ietver visus labojumfailus un drošības labojumus, kas tika iekļauta iepriekšējā kumulatīvajā atjauninājumā. Skatiet jaunākos SQL Server kumulatīvie atjauninājumi:
Risinājums
Lai novērstu šo problēmu, varat izmantot tālāk norādītās metodes.
-
Varat jOin krātuves pūla tabulu ar lokālo tabulu.
-
Vispirms varat ievietot datus lokālajā tabulā un pēc tam lasīt lokālo tabulu datus, lai ievietotu datu pūlā.
Atsauces
Uzziniet par terminoloģiju , ko Microsoft izmanto, lai aprakstītu programmatūras atjauninājumus.